The Bell UH-1 Iroquois, colloquially known as Huey, is a single-engine turboshaft military helicopter equipped with two-bladed main and tail rotors. Intended for medical evacuation and utility purposes, it was designed by Bell Helicopter in 1952 and made its maiden flight on October 20th, 1956. Production began in March 1960, marking the UH-1 as the first turbine-powered helicopter for the US military. Over 16,000 units have been produced globally.
